Cafeteria Rolls Out New and Healthier Food Choices
By Plapol Rattapitak, Photographer
Apr 12, 2019
Chicken tenders, vegetarian pizza, Buffalo chicken balls, cheese puffs and other new items for breakfast in the classroom, lunch and after school were taste tested by Mr. Jacob Ferrin’s ASB class and Mr. Ron Goins’s fourth period English class on April 10. Comments about the new offerings ranged from “the chicken tenders were amazing,” to “the pizza tasted frozen and stale.”
